Output 2bf6e20ab7aa3c6e26b559c2ca64c0a982a366ebeee1fa37ae0034d3c7212fef:62

value
502198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c68dd829d84ee2d99aa23cb979a84c34ac73f1f OP_EQUAL
address
3BaEXRoVk7YamsELKvhgPXssKfCfWDiRWA
transaction
2bf6e20ab7aa3c6e26b559c2ca64c0a982a366ebeee1fa37ae0034d3c7212fef
confirmations
212035
spent
true